变压器多维信息融合及状态评估

摘    要:为提高变压器状态评估的准确性,针对传统变压器状态评估方法选取单一指的不足,提出了利用物联网实现多维信息融合的变压器状态参数评估方法。该方法选取常用变压器型式试验参数指标作为在线监测指标,再对指标进行归一化处理。利用物联网对归一化后的指标实现不同指标信息的互联互通,在此基础上利用支持概率改进的DS证据理论对状态指标进行融合,搭建变压器状态参数评估模型。通过实验表明,该方法的状态评估准确性得到很大提升。

关 键 词:变压器  状态评估  在线监测  DS证据理论  信息融合

 Multidimensional information fusion and state evaluation of transformer

Abstract:In order to improve the accuracy of transformer condition assessment,a method of transformer condition parameter assessment based on multi-dimensional information fusion using Internet of Things is proposed to overcome the shortcomings of single finger in traditional transformer condition assessment methods.In this method,the parameters of transformer type test are selected as the on-line monitoring indexes,and then the indexes are normalized.The normalized indices are interconnected by the Internet of Things.On this basis,the state indices are fused by the DS evidenceS theory supporting probability improvement,and the state parameter evaluation model of transformer is built.Experiments show that the accuracy of state assessment is greatly improved.
Keywords:,transformer, state assessment, on-line monitoring, DS evidence theory, information fusion
